Helsinki, Finland March 10, 2009 -- Opticon and Capricode begin cooperation in PDA device
management. The Opticon’s H16 and H19 Windows Mobile PDA devices can be managed centrally and over-the-air with Capricode’s SyncShield® mobile device management solution. This means Opticon’s state of the art PDA devices together with Capricode SyncShield® device management solution enables companies to fully exploit the benefits of smartphones in their daily working life.
The SyncShield® device management tool and its centralized operations, enable significant cost savings for organizations, whilst ensuring the devices security and operability. With SyncShield®, the companies using Opticon’s PDA devices can for example, manage the device applications and settings without interrupting the actual device user.
Mobile device convergence is here today with computer-like smartphones and PDAs, which are a necessity for today´s mobile workers. The devices that include advanced applications, enhanced memory capabilities and varying connectivity possibilities (WiFi, Bluetooth, GPRS/EDGE, GPS like in Opticon H16 and H19 has) have enabled a completely new way to utilize smartphones at work. This creates a novel need for comprehensive device management, support and security. Managing tens or even thousands of devices manually is time consuming and difficult. Therefore a comprehensive device management tool like SyncShield®, which enables simultaneous, over-the-air device management, is an efficient instrument for an organisation’s IT administration.

About Opticon:
Opticon started more than 30 years ago with the production of auto-ID devices in Japan. From reliable and lightweight scanners to rugged programmable terminals and even Windows based smart phones with an integrated scan engine. Opticon offers a complete range of Auto-ID devices. The production facility is situated in Japan. This is an ISO-certified production facility. The products are distributed from the European head office in the Netherlands to regional offices and customers. Amongst others, Opticon is active in the retail, healthcare, logistics and mobility industry. (www.opticon.com).

About Capricode:
Capricode is privately owned Finnish company that offers telecommunication software solutions for businesses. Capricode helps carriers and enterprises cut costs and boost revenue streams with its efficient mobile telecommunication software solutions. Capricode's flagship product is SyncShield®, a mobile device management product for the remote and centralized management of business smartphone applications, settings and security. Hundreds of the company's products have been installed globally over the past 10 years. Capricode is a privately owned company whose head office is located in Oulu, Finland, the mobile hotspot of Europe. Capricode´s sight is strongly set on international expansion. (www.capricode.com )
